centos7查看所有用户;CentOS7用户查看
CentOS7是一种基于Linux内核的操作系统,广泛应用于服务器和个人电脑。在CentOS7上,用户可以通过多种方式查看所有用户的信息。详细介绍在CentOS7上查看所有用户的方法和步骤。
1. 使用命令行查看用户信息
在CentOS7上,用户可以通过命令行来查看所有用户的信息。我们需要打开终端,然后输入以下命令:
$ cat /etc/passwd
这个命令会显示所有用户的信息,包括用户名、用户ID、用户所属的组ID、用户的家目录以及默认的shell。通过这些信息,我们可以了解到系统上存在的所有用户。
2. 使用GUI界面查看用户信息
除了命令行,CentOS7还提供了GUI界面来查看用户信息。在桌面环境下,我们可以通过以下步骤来查看所有用户:
– 点击屏幕左上角的”Applications”按钮,然后选择”System Tools”,再选择”Users and Groups”。
– 在打开的”Users and Groups”窗口中,可以看到所有用户的列表。点击每个用户,可以查看用户的详细信息,包括用户名、用户ID、用户所属的组ID等。
通过GUI界面,用户可以更直观地查看和管理所有用户的信息。
3. 查看用户的登录历史
在CentOS7上,用户还可以查看其他用户的登录历史。登录历史记录了用户的登录时间、登录IP地址等信息,可以帮助用户了解系统的使用情况。要查看用户的登录历史,可以执行以下命令:
$ last
这个命令会显示最近的登录记录,包括登录用户、登录时间、登录IP地址等信息。通过查看登录历史,用户可以监控系统的安全性。
4. 查看用户的权限
在CentOS7上,每个用户都有自己的权限。权限决定了用户可以执行的操作范围,包括读取文件、写入文件、执行程序等。要查看用户的权限,可以执行以下命令:
$ id [用户名]
这个命令会显示用户的权限信息,包括用户所属的组、用户的UID和GID等。通过查看用户的权限,用户可以了解自己的操作范围。
5. 查看用户的进程
在CentOS7上,用户可以查看自己的进程信息。进程是指在系统中运行的程序的实例,每个进程都有自己的进程ID和运行状态。要查看用户的进程信息,可以执行以下命令:
$ ps -u [用户名]
这个命令会显示指定用户的进程列表,包括进程ID、进程状态、进程所属的终端等信息。通过查看用户的进程,用户可以了解自己正在运行的程序。
6. 查看用户的登录状态
在CentOS7上,用户可以查看其他用户的登录状态。登录状态记录了用户当前是否登录系统,以及登录的终端和登录时间等信息。要查看用户的登录状态,可以执行以下命令:
$ who
这个命令会显示当前登录系统的用户列表,包括用户名、登录终端、登录时间等信息。通过查看用户的登录状态,用户可以了解其他用户的活动情况。
7. 查看用户的文件和目录
在CentOS7上,用户可以查看自己的文件和目录。文件和目录是用户存储数据和程序的地方,每个用户都有自己的家目录。要查看用户的文件和目录,可以执行以下命令:
$ ls -l /home/[用户名]
这个命令会显示指定用户的家目录下的文件和目录列表,包括文件的权限、文件的所有者、文件的大小等信息。通过查看用户的文件和目录,用户可以管理自己的数据和程序。
8. 查看用户的日志
在CentOS7上,用户可以查看系统的日志文件。日志文件记录了系统的运行情况和事件,可以帮助用户了解系统的状态和故障。要查看用户的日志,可以执行以下命令:
$ tail /var/log/messages
这个命令会显示最近的系统日志信息。用户可以根据需要查看其他日志文件,如登录日志、安全日志等。
通过以上方法,用户可以在CentOS7上查看所有用户的信息、登录历史、权限、进程、登录状态、文件和目录以及日志等。这些信息可以帮助用户了解系统的使用情况和安全性,提高系统管理的效率。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/78494.html<